Biology Student Organizations
The Department of Biological Sciences is proud to offer students four opportunities to participate in life science student organizations. Delegates from each organization comprise a Life Science Student Organization Leadership Council which facilitates the coordination and collaboration of the organizations' activities. All participants become members of The Biology Club, and students who have particular areas of interest choose to participate in the Louisiana Iota Chapter of Alpha Epsilon Delta, The LSUS Chapter of Beta Beta Beta (tri-Beta), or the Minority Association of Pre-Healthcare Students (MAPS). | PURPOSE To bring together Biology, Chemistry, Computer Science, and Math students with the Medical field, to solve complex life science problems. The BIG will work on promoting the interdisciplinary field of Biomedical Informatics that deals with the storage, retrieval, sharing, and optimal use of biomedical information, data, and knowledge for problem solving and decision making, touching on all basic and applied fields in biomedical science and is closely tied to modern information technologies. BIG will hold meetings to broaden the horizons of its members involve them into biomedical informatics projects and provide access to the experts in the field. |
